WebPolymyxin B Sulfate and Trimethoprim Ophthalmic Solution is indicated in the treatment of surface ocular bacterial infections, including acute bacterial conjunctivitis, and … Web1 to 2 drops 4 times daily for 5 to 7 days. Specific approach. Bacterial conjunctivitis*. Erythromycin 5 mg/gram ophthalmic ointment. 0.5 inch (1.25 cm) 4 times daily for 5 to 7 days. OR. Trimethoprim-polymyxin B 0.1%-10,000 units/mL ophthalmic drops. 1 to 2 drops 4 times daily for 5 to 7 days. OR.
